Ingredients List
Gathering the right ingredients is super important for whipping up these delicious nye party snacks. Here’s what you’ll need:
- 1 cup of cheese cubes (I love using a mix of sharp cheddar and creamy gouda for flavor)
- 1 cup of mixed nuts (choose your favorites—salty, roasted, or even spiced!)
- 1 cup of mini pretzels (the crunch adds such a nice texture)
- 1 cup of grape tomatoes (halved for easy snacking—so juicy!)
- 1 cup of sliced cucumbers (refreshingly crisp, perfect for dipping)
- 1 cup of hummus (store-bought or homemade, your choice!)
Feel free to get creative and swap in any of your favorite snacks or dips. It’s all about what you love!
How to Prepare Instructions
Preparing these nye party snacks is as easy as pie—no cooking required! Here’s how to get everything ready:
- Start by grabbing a large serving platter. This is where all the magic will happen!
- On one side of the platter, arrange the cheese cubes in a colorful display. I like to mix up the types of cheese for a fun variety.
- Next to the cheese, add your mixed nuts. Scatter them around for a rustic look—trust me, it adds charm!
- Now, take a bowl and fill it with mini pretzels. Set this bowl on the platter or nearby for easy access.
- Halve your grape tomatoes and arrange them on the platter. Their bright red color is so inviting!
- Slice your cucumbers into rounds and place them alongside the tomatoes. They bring a nice crunch!
- Finally, serve the hummus in a small bowl right in the center of the platter. This will be the perfect dip for all those fresh veggies and pretzels.
And voilà! Your platter of delectable snacks is ready to impress your guests. Don’t worry if it doesn’t look perfect; the key is to have fun while assembling!

Variations
If you’re looking to switch things up with your nye party snacks, I’ve got some fun ideas for you! Try adding a zesty guacamole or a tangy tzatziki dip to complement the hummus. For snacks, consider including some crispy pita chips or spicy popcorn for an extra crunch. You can also swap out the cucumbers for colorful bell pepper strips or add in some snap peas for a nice crunch. And if you want to elevate the cheese game, try some marinated feta or goat cheese for a gourmet touch. Mix and match to keep your guests excited and satisfied!
Storage & Reheating Instructions
If you happen to have any leftovers from your nye party snacks (which is rare, but it can happen!), storing them properly is key to keeping everything fresh. Just pop the leftovers in an airtight container and stash them in the fridge. They should stay good for about 2-3 days. If you’ve got leftover hummus, it’ll keep well for about a week, too!
As for reheating, there’s no need! These snacks are best enjoyed cold and crunchy. Just pull them out of the fridge when you’re ready to dive in again. Happy snacking!

FAQ Section
Got some questions about these delicious nye party snacks? I’ve got you covered! First off, yes, you can absolutely make these ahead of time. Just prepare your platter a few hours before your guests arrive and keep it covered in the fridge. That way, you can enjoy the festivities without any last-minute stress!
Now, if you’re wondering about nut alternatives, you can easily swap out the mixed nuts for seeds, like pumpkin or sunflower seeds, for a nut-free option. Also, feel free to get creative with your dips! If hummus isn’t your thing, try a bean dip or a yogurt-based dip instead. The key is to tailor the snacks to your guests’ preferences, ensuring everyone has something to munch on while ringing in the New Year!
